In the wake of rising hostilities between India and Pakistan following a terrorist attack in Jammu and Kashmir, speculation about the possible cancellation of the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2025 started making headlines.
Both the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) and IPL Chairman Arun Dhumal have firmly confirmed that IPL 2025 will not be cancelled, and necessary steps are being taken to ensure the safety of players, officials, and fans.

Due to the volatile situation in certain border states, the BCCI has already relocated at least one IPL fixture. The Punjab Kings vs Mumbai Indians match, initially scheduled in Dharamsala, was shifted to Ahmedabad after the closure of the Dharamsala airport and increased military activity in the region. BCCI Secretary Devajit Saikia emphasized that logistical and security concerns led to this decision, not fear among the players.
Foreign Players Comfortable, Says BCCI
According to rumors about possible withdrawals by international cricketers, Saikia reassured fans that foreign players are comfortable and committed to completing the tournament.
He says none of the franchises have reported discomfort or intent to pull out. All players have been informed, and enhanced security protocols have been introduced.

IPL Chairman Arun Dhumal has also endorsed the ICC’s decision to hold India-Pakistan matches at neutral venues until 2027. He noted that it clarifies scheduling and eases pressure on the host nations, especially given the current tensions.
While this policy applies to ICC tournaments, it underscores the broader challenges in organizing bilateral matches between the two countries.
Inzamam-ul-Haq Urges Boycott of IPL by Foreign Players
Meanwhile, former Pakistan captain Inzamam-ul-Haq called on foreign cricket boards to reconsider sending players to the IPL. His statement referenced the BCCI’s long-standing policy of not allowing Indian cricketers to participate in overseas T20 leagues. However, this view hasn’t received official backing from other cricket boards, and the participation of foreign stars in IPL 2025 remains unaffected.
IPL 2025 is progressing smoothly despite geopolitical tensions, with modified schedules and enhanced security. The BCCI and IPL management remain committed to hosting the tournament without compromising safety. While the situation between India and Pakistan remains tense, the cricketing community continues to support the spirit of the game.
